Charleston National Homes

Charleston National is a gorgeous community located right on the Intracoastal Waterway of Charleston. This is an established neighborhood so lots have large oak trees and established landscaping, making for a beautiful setting to call home.

Like many of the neighborhoods in Mt. Pleasant, this community also has a wide variety of housing prices and options. The golf course and waterway provide many lots with gorgeous views, just steps off the porch.

With golf being the main feature of this neighborhood, the Rees Jones course, designed with Augusta National in mind, is fantastic with lagoons, live oaks, and picturesque views to enjoy. If golf doesn’t suit you, swim in the pools, go to the country club or enjoy the play area with your children. The schools in this area are excellent with good public schools and many private schools to choose from. Overall, this neighborhood does not disappoint and provides an environment that people will stay in for the long term.
